Package org.eclipse.epsilon.egl
Interface IEglModule
- All Superinterfaces:
IEolModule
,IModule
,ModuleElement
- All Known Implementing Classes:
EglModule
,EglTemplateFactoryModuleAdapter
- Since:
- 1.6
-
Method Summary
Modifier and TypeMethodDescriptionboolean
void
reset()
void
setDefaultFormatters
(Collection<Formatter> defaultFormatters) void
setTemplateFactory
(EglTemplateFactory factory) Methods inherited from interface org.eclipse.epsilon.eol.IEolModule
configure, createDebugger, execute, getConfigurationProperties, getDeclaredModelDeclarations, getDeclaredOperations, getImportManager, getImports, getMain, getModelDeclarations, getOperations, getParentModule, getParseProblems, getPostOperationStatements, parse, setContext, setImportManager, setParentModule
Methods inherited from interface org.eclipse.epsilon.common.module.IModule
createAst, getSourceUri, parse, parse, parse, parse, parse
Methods inherited from interface org.eclipse.epsilon.common.module.ModuleElement
build, getChildren, getComments, getData, getFile, getModule, getParent, getRegion, getUri, setModule, setParent, setRegion, setUri
-
Method Details
-
getContext
IEglContext getContext()- Specified by:
getContext
in interfaceIEolModule
-
getTemplateFactory
EglTemplateFactory getTemplateFactory() -
setTemplateFactory
-
getCurrentTemplate
EglTemplate getCurrentTemplate() -
parse
- Throws:
Exception
-
reset
void reset() -
setDefaultFormatters
-